Red Bull demand change at next week's crunch meeting

Red Bull have called for change to the way the sport is governed, as well as regulation changes surrounding engines and aerodynamics at a crunch meeting next week. His comments come amid calls from senior figures at Williams and Lotus that want stability, rather than the change Red Bull are calling for, which they believe will widen the gap and reduce the spectacle. The teams, the FIA and FOM represented by Bernie Ecclestone will meet on Thursday at Biggin Hill to discuss what changes are required to overhaul the sport for 2017.
